Etymology

The name Kakundu is derived from the Oshiwambo root word ‘eku’, which relates to the concept of earth or ground.

Linguistic family: Niger-Congo > Atlantic-Congo > Benue-Congo > Bantu > Southern > Oshiwambo

Cultural context

In Ovambo culture, names often reflect the environment and natural elements. Kakundu signifies a connection to the earth, symbolizing stability and groundedness.

Symbolism

The name Kakundu symbolizes a strong connection to the earth, representing stability, strength, and a sense of belonging.

Naming ceremony

Ovambo naming ceremonies traditionally involve the community and include rituals to bless the child with traits associated with their name.
